What Are Nominators?

In a blockchain network that utilizes the nominated proof-of-stake (NPoS) consensus algorithm, nominators are one of the two main actors, the other being validators.

In traditional proof-of-stake (PoS) networks, an entity’s mining or validation power is determined by the number of network tokens they hold.

More tokens increase mining power and influence decision-making processes, such as government functions and voting on network proposals.

However, not all validators or miners actively participate in every decision-making event.

They may be unavailable or choose not to vote for various reasons, including a lack of time or resources to understand complex technical considerations.

Enhancing Network Participation

The nominated proof-of-stake (NPoS) algorithm, used by blockchains like Polkadot and Kusama, addresses this challenge.

NPoS introduces the concept of nominators to enhance network participation and decision-making.

In NPoS, validators and nominators have complementary roles:

  • Validators: Validators secure the network by producing new and validating parachain blocks. They continuously operate and use native tokens to back their validator status. Validators are incentivized to follow the protocol rules, as violations can result in penalties (slashing) or rewards based on their adherence to the rules.
  • Nominators: Nominators are token holders who, for various reasons, do not actively participate in the consensus process. Instead, they use their tokens to nominate validators they trust or believe will perform well. Nominators are motivated to nominate validators because they earn a share of the rewards received by their nominated validators in active slots. Like validators, nominators must abide by the protocol rules or face penalties.

Validators are elected to participate in every active set, a specific period that can increase as the blockchain progresses.

Nominators play a crucial role in this process by selecting and nominating validators.

Validators who receive more nominations and have a higher value of tokens backing them are more likely to be elected into the active set of validators.

Promoting Decentralization

In NPoS, the distribution of rewards is proportional to the validator’s overall stake.

This incentivizes nominators to consider a diverse group of validators instead of repeatedly nominating the same ones.

Additionally, nominators are incentivized to conduct due diligence on validators to ensure they behave appropriately, as misbehaving validators can result in reduced rewards for them.

Overall, the NPoS algorithm promotes decentralization in blockchain networks by maximizing decision-making power while ensuring fairness through proportional representation and incentivizing nominators to select validators thoughtfully.
